SisterLovlie made some a pasta salad and coleslaw with sultanas. Both were nice and simple to make. Ingredients for the pasta salad were boiled pasta, chick peas, sweet corn, roasted broad beans, tomatoes, black olives, lettuce and vegan salad cream. The coleslaw was just shredded cabbage, raisins, vegan salad cream, salt and sugar.


For today I made pizza. It’s been a while since I made pizza and was badly craving for it. I tried something new with the dough. I made a sort of ciabatta base dough but it is not quite like I wanted it to me. It did not rise as much as I was expecting. But then I had never made real ciabattas before. I need a little bit of practice with it. I am quite happy though as the base was crusty and it tasted nice.
As ingredients I had tofu strips (marinated in soy sauce, coated with cornflour, then sautéed), cauliflower, mushroom, onions, baby corn, black and green olives, pineapple, and green chilies. I marinated the chillies in some vinegar, salt and sugar for about 1 hour before.
I like chilies but I don’t like them too hot, because then they take away the taste completely and put me off my food! So I find soaking them in vinegar makes them more reasonable to ingest!
